This was our first time staying at a hipcamp and we had a great time, we would definitely recommend staying here and would love to come back if we are in the area in the future. A beautiful area with the reservoir nearby and our campsite was so peaceful and relaxing next to the creek!
Mark was so friendly and welcoming when he visited our site to check in on us and invited us to explore the farm beyond our site.
The written directions on hipcamp were really helpful and the property was well signed from the front gate all the way down to the sites. To get to the Weeping Willow site, once you get down to the creek cross the little bridge (the willow tree this site was named after was washed away in recent floods) and the site is immediately on the left.
The sites are nice and big and very spread out, the closest campers from us would have been at least a few hundred metres away.
Bring insect repellent and red lights for night time to help with the bugs.
